IT MindFinders is conducting a client search for an Enterprise Infrastructure Architect (EIA) who will design and maintain the target Infrastructure object model and assess the impact of the future business architecture on existing and future Infrastructures architecture. The EAI will work with other architects to determine the most appropriate Infrastructure partitioning to achieve the performance and scalability requirements in accordance with the business and IT strategies.
The EIA will engage with vendors and analysts to understand Infrastructures trends and futures and ensure our client is positioned to take advantage of new directions for Infrastructures. The EIA will participate in business and technology planning sessions and anticipate future business/technology changes. Working with Business, Information and Application Architects will review business drivers, needs and strategies and understand implications to the Infrastructure architecture. The EIA will also work closely with the operations department to define proper platforms for applications defining strategy that will allow growth.
